Angry Advice upon being stiffed

A guy -not on LS1Tech (no trader ratings, low post count, shame on me)- stiffed me for a couple hundred bucks worth of parts - one part specifically.

Did it on paypal, but I am way past the 45 day statute of limitations, mostly because he geve me lots of excuses, I didn't need it right then, and I am a nice guy. But now I am an extremely pissed guy, and I want my money back, since I don't think he even has the part I want. In our most recent phone convo (2 weeks ago) he said he sent it, but would not provide tracking information, and did not even remember what address he sent it to.

He doesn't go to that site anymore, in fact, I found most of the forums he used to be on, and he's not posted on any of them in a month, but the one in his hometown has more or less blackballed him too, as everyone decided he was a chump there as well. I signed up for that one, and someone who knew him said "kick him in the face." Amusing, but less than practical.

I do have: his cell number, his AIM name, two of his email addresses, and the phone number to his local sherriff's department, as well as where he works, and every PM to and from him about this xaction - somewhere around 70 I think.

I leave vms, since last week he stopped taking my calls. I email sometimes. I AIMed him today. He did not immediately log off or block me.

But I am at a loss. Any ideas besides bodily harm/threat of bodily harm?

Unfortunately, it may be a situation of your word against his. Can you prove he didn't mail it? It doesn't matter if he can't prove he did because you can't prove he didn't. Without solid evidence of a crime, FBI won't investigate. I reported a mail fraud incident to the FBI before, and they pretty much told me the same thing. Crap gets lost all the time. This is why I always insist on delivery confirmation and insurance on any and all shipments coming to me (that, or pay extra and insist on UPS to get tracking information). I've been burned more than once with E-Bay to the point where I will go there only as a last resort.
